Cica is a nickname for its scientific name centella asiatica, and is also referred to as gotu kola, Indian Pennywort and tiger grass. The leafy green plant is grown in countries such as India, Sri Lanka and China. It’s been a staple in Chinese medicine for centuries and is now a hugely popular skincare ingredient.
Cica is best known for its healing abilities as it helps reduce and repair inflammation while also hydrating the skin. Madecassic acid is one of the active compounds in cica and plays a key role in suppressing inflammation by inhibiting the release of pro-inflammatory cytokines. Cica extract is also packed with vitamin C, vitamin A, vitamin B1 and B2, niacin and carotene, which combine to brighten skin and fight premature aging.
Cica helps skin to heal quickly and effectively and so is perfect for those with inflamed acne or highly sensitive skin. Cica is also helps to fight signs of premature aging as it protects against external sources of skin damage, such as pollution

The hairline-thin Aqua Deep mask is designed to maximize the moisture your skin absorbs.It’s main ingredients are: naturally-derived papain, found in the leaves, latex, roots and fruit of the papaya which helps to exfoliate the skin by removing sebum and dead skin cells, and a lavender ampoule, which deeply hydrates, calms and relaxes your skin.
With the Aqua Deep Mask, your moisturized and relaxed face will say “thank you.” It can also be used in the evening when you’re settling in after a long day at work.
And if you are in a hurry, this mask could be for you, as you get 3 steps of care with one mask -- exfoliation, ampoule treatment and a deep mask that locks in moisture.
Some masks fail to adhere to the skin properly, but not the Deep Mask from Dewytree. With the ultrafine fiber sheet, it adheres to the skin perfectly in an airtight, but comfortable fashion which will ensure your skin captures all of the moisture from the mask as well as any serum or essence you choose to apply prior to sheet masking. The fiber system design will also spread moisture to your skin evenly. What’s more, after you’re done, this mask won’t leave behind any sticky residue, due to the fresh ingredients and their interaction with the skin.
And why is the mask green? Good question. The green enzyme papain (mentioned above) extracted from papaya is the reason. Papain naturally interrupts sebum oxidation to purify the skin and take away dead skin cells.
